Preparation

Before an adventure or trip, you may want to go and gather food, it is good to spend a couple of days at base before you set off.

Tools

Do not bring any valuables unless the purpose of the adventure is for resources, if within in that case bring a spare, You are better off with iron as it can be easily replaced with iron farms or mining.

Food

Bring a stack (64) of cooked meat of any kind, Otherwise bring supplies for farming in the case you will be away from your base for a long period of time.

Blocks

Bring a couple stacks of wood and cobblestone in the event you will be away from your base for a long time, this will prove handy in making small bases, however you do not need to gather blocks if you decide to live in caves, which you still shouldn't neglect keeping some, as you will need a crafting table or furnace.

Travelling

Use horses! Try and get a fast one, but the jumping ability is not a major concern, however it may be handy for jumping across rivers or 2-block tall structures. If on feet, avoid sprinting to conserve food.

Leaving base

Storage

Make sure to leave anything that you don't need, this will be quite useful when exploring for otherworldly resources.

Base

Make sure that nothing can go in apart from yourself, this can be as simple as closing or blocking up a door. Make sure the base is lit up so that mobs don't spawn inside of it, Make sure to keep your tamed mobs somewhere secure so you don't end up taking them with you unknowingly.

Livestock

Make sure to breed all your livestock, so that when you come back you have lots of more animals to work with.
